Fun Christmas mystery rom-com

Ally Carter, you've done it again. Please keep writing books--I will keep reading them. I had so much fun reading this book and could have easily finished it within a few days of starting. Two things prevented me, and neither of them had anything to do with the book itself. First, the two weeks I read this book were ridiculously busy, leaving me little time to just sit and indulge in it. Second, this was a buddy read with my husband, so we'd read to a certain chapter and then wait for the other person to catch up before continuing. We both loved the book and enjoyed talking to each other about it. This book is a cozy Christmas mystery rom-com, which isn't something I've read before. And what a way to pull me into a new group of books! Can't go wrong with this one (or Ally Carter). I loved Maggie and Ethan, individually and together. Their wit and their banter throughout the book were entertaining but not unrealistic. They each had enough backstory for the reader to understand them but not necessarily predict them. I love the way Ethan supported Maggie and helped her build her confidence in herself. (Btw, my husband commented on this over and over, too.) They were both brilliant. There are only two things I wanted to have explained but weren't: 1) The escape from the locked room. 2) All the texts Ethen got during their flight. I’m fairly certain I know the answer, but the problem is that the number of people doesn’t add up. Note: A little bit of swearing.
